Ireland's best sailor to be decided next month

A fleet of national winners and Olympic athletes will gather in Dun Laoghaire in early October to decide Ireland's best sailor for 2002 in the Allianz ISA Helmsman Championship.

The two-day event will be staged at the Royal St George Yacht Club and will be sailed using the International Dragon class keelboat.

The line-up of invitees for the event is headed by 2001 winner Fergal Kinsella from Howth YC.

Currently training in a 2.4m single-hander, this wheelchair athlete held a practice session in a Dragon last week and later confirmed he would be willing to defend his title in the class.

Nominations for the event are made in two ways. Irish classes that have 26 or more national entries automatically nominate their best sailor.

Alternatively, a special Irish Sailing Association committee convenes to nominate 'wild cards' from the panel of elite crews and other top sailors.

Among the top class nominations are several top Irish club and international level sailors.

The 1720 class fields Maurice 'Prof' O'Connell who recently won the European Championship in the UK helming Des Feherty's Aquatack.

Barry O'Neill represents the J24 fleet and was top Irish boat at the recent Europeans on Dublin Bay where he scored eighth overall.

Among the leading nominations are: Maria Coleman, World No 2 in the Europe Class and major Olympic prospect; David Burrows - top Irish sailor at Sydney in the Finn single-hander and another potential for Athens 2004; Tom Fitzpatrick - three times winner of the Helmsman Championship and Olympic contender; John Twomey - top Paralympic sailor and Athens prospect.

The class nominations for the Allianz ISA Helmsman Championship 2002 are as follows:

· Laser Radial Conor Walsh

· Flying Fifteen Justin Burke

· Laser Russell McGovern

· GP14 Hugh Gill

· Squib Ruan O'Tiarnaigh

· Fireball Louis Smythe

· Multihull Neil Mangan

· Shannon OD David Dickson

· 420 Stefan Hyde

· Dragon Neil Hegarty

· Mermaid Sam Shiels

· Cruisers III Brian O'Neill

· J24 Barry O'Neill

· Ruffian 23 Graham Miles

· 1720 Maurice O'Connell

· Wayfarer Paul Killeen

Other wildcard nominations for the Allianz ISA Helmsman Championship to date include Gerald (Gerbil) Owens – 2000 Winner and Athens prospect; Conor Clancy - third in Laser II European Championship; Anthony O'Leary - 1720 Scottish series winner; Ciara Peelo - Bronze Medal at Laser Radial Worlds.
